golang服务器贵吗

发布时间:2024-10-02 20:07:33

作为一名专业的Golang开发者,我对Golang服务器的贵价问题有着深入的思考和独到的见解。毫无疑问,Golang服务器在市场上定位较为高端,价格相对较贵。但是,为什么Golang服务器贵呢?下面我将从技术优势、性能表现和商业价值等方面来说明这个问题。

技术优势

Golang作为一门新兴的编程语言,具备着许多独特的技术优势。首先,Golang具备强大的并发处理能力,它利用goroutine和channel可以轻松地实现高并发的运行环境。其次,Golang拥有简洁而高效的语法结构,代码可读性高,易于维护。此外,Golang还具备丰富的标准库和强大的生态系统,开发者可以在很大程度上减少重复造轮子的工作量。这些技术优势使得Golang在服务器开发领域表现出色,提升了开发效率和代码质量。

性能表现

Golang专注于并发处理和高性能,在服务器领域特别适用。相比传统的服务器开发语言,如PHP和Java,Golang的性能表现更为出色。首先,Golang采用了垃圾回收机制,自动管理内存,减少了开发者在内存管理上的负担。其次,Golang利用协程(goroutine)和调度器(Scheduler)的配合,实现高并发的并行计算任务,进一步提升了服务器的性能。最后,Golang编译成机器码后,具有较低的运行时开销,不需要虚拟机或解释器的支持,因此可以获得更好的执行效率。这些性能优势使得Golang服务器在处理高并发和大数据量的场景下,有着明显的优势和竞争力。

商业价值

Golang服务器的贵价也与其带来的商业价值密不可分。首先,Golang作为一门新兴的技术,具备较高的市场需求和潜在业务机会。目前,许多创业公司和互联网巨头都在使用Golang来构建高性能的服务端应用。其次,Golang具备强大的跨平台特性,可在多个操作系统上运行,为企业节省了部署和维护的成本。此外,Golang还支持容器技术,可以与Docker等容器化平台无缝集成,提供更好的可移植性和弹性伸缩能力。这些商业价值使得Golang服务器成为许多企业选择的首选。

综上所述,尽管Golang服务器相对较贵,但它的技术优势、性能表现和商业价值都是无法忽视的。作为一名专业的Golang开发者,我们应该深入了解Golang的特性和优势,充分发挥其潜力,为企业实现业务增长和竞争优势提供有力支持。

相关推荐